The Walking Dead: Dead City is one of several new Walking Dead spinoffs in production at AMC Networks. This series will see a reunion of Maggie (Lauren Cohan) and Negan (Jeffrey Dean Morgan.) With a scheduled release date of April 2023, fans are highly anticipating this series as they try to figure out what will pair these two characters together.

Dead City will be set in Manhattan, a location cut off from the mainland early in the outbreak. During the course of the apocalypse, the island has been overrun by a horde of the undead that is over 1 million strong.  The remaining citizens live above the tenth floor of the buildings and use ziplines to travel between them.

There have been no announcements about what will take Maggie and Negan to Manhattan, and fans are curious how this will come about. In the series finale of The Walking Dead, Maggie and Negan had an emotional conversation about Maggie’s inability to forgive Negan for her husband Glenn’s (Steven Yeun) death. Maggie shared that when she tries to remember Glenn, she sees his bashed in head and Negan smiling at his work.

The Walking Dead: Dead City will begin a few years after the 1-year time jump seen in the last episode of the flagship series. During the one-year time jump, Maggie was once again leading Hilltop, a community that had been built up again after the destruction of the Whisperer war in season 10. She mentions to Carol (Melissa McBride) and Daryl (Norman Reedus) that she wants to discuss the future. She says, “There’s a lot out there to find out about. And I think it’s time we did.”

Negan, his wife Annie (Medina Senghore), and his child, which would have been born by this time, are noticeably absent in the one-year time jump. This shows Negan did go his own way, similar to his comic book counterpart.

The newest photos released for the new series show that the reunion between Maggie and Negan may not be pleasant.

In a recent interview with Entertainment Weekly, Morgan mentioned that Negan might return to some of his former behaviors, leading to a tense reunion between these two characters.

Only time will tell how things evolve in Maggie and Negan’s lives to bring them back together on a mission far from their homes.
